Anti-climbing lattice column net
Technical field
The utility model belongs to security protection silk screen field, and in particular to a kind of anti-climbing lattice column net.
Background technique
Anti-climbing lattice column net is typically employed in the places such as airport, factory, military affairs, prison, and effect is to prevent personnel from climbing It climbs, plays safe barrier action, currently used mesh sheet fixed form is that mesh sheet is pressed on column using press strip, and passes through certainly Tapping is fixed, and this mode is simple, low in cost, but it is small to be reserved in the clear size of opening on column, not easy to install, separately Outer self-tapping screw is not generally corrosion-resistant, can corrode after long-time outdoor application, also, is by it when self-tapping screw installation Screw thread voluntarily tapping on the through-hole of column is easy to beat when being installed using electric screwdriver, and self-tapping screw and column are sent out Raw slide fastener, causes self-tapping screw to fall off, influences installation effect or even mesh sheet is fallen, and can not play the role of stablizing installation.

Specific embodiment
With reference to the accompanying drawing and specific embodiment the utility model is described in further detail:
Specific embodiment is as shown in Figures 1 to 5, anti-climbing lattice column net, including column 1 and mesh sheet 2, and mesh sheet 2 is by press strip 3 It forms a fixed connection with column 1, the column 1 is hollow tubular structure, has additional overhanging piece 5, overhanging piece 5 on press strip 3 End be fixed with nut 6, inserting hole 10 is provided on press strip 3, is provided with bolt 4 in inserting hole 10, bolt 4 is preferably round end Bolt can prevent personnel from trampling and climb upwards on bolt 4.The central axis of bolt 4 is overlapped with the central axis of nut 6, It is had additional on column 1 and places window 7 and interspersed window 8, placed and be installed with tranverse connecting plate between window 7 and interspersed window 8, nut 6 is by overhanging Piece 5, which passes through, places window 7, and overhanging piece 5 and press strip 3 are clamped in tranverse connecting plate two sides, and bolt 4 passes through inserting hole 10 and interspersed window 8 and spiral shell Mother 6, which is formed, to be threadedly coupled.
It is welded and fixed as fixing end and the press strip 3 to further improvement of the utility model, overhanging piece 5, overhanging piece 5 Free end, which tilts, simultaneously forms V-structure with press strip 3, and the free end of overhanging piece 5 is arranged in nut 6, in this way nut 6 is inserted into it is vertical Simpler convenience when in column 1.
The positive stop strip being clamped with mesh sheet 2 is respectively arranged with as the two sides to further improvement of the utility model, press strip 3 9, positive stop strip 9 is welded and fixed with press strip 3.Be clamped using positive stop strip 9 and mesh sheet 2, can prevent mesh sheet 2 from press strip 3 and column 1 it Between slip, connect stronger reliable.Mesh sheet is the fenestral fabric formed that interweaved by cross bar and vertical pole, in order to preferably play Anti-climbing effect, all cross bars are all disposed within the outside of vertical pole, and positive stop strip 9 is vertically arranged on the outside of cross bar, positive stop strip 9 it is straight Diameter is equal to the diameter of vertical pole, and positive stop strip 9 is located in mesh sheet 2 between two neighboring vertical pole and is clamped with the vertical pole close to column 1, can To function well as anti-off effect.
As to further improvement of the utility model, mesh sheet 2 is to weld shape by the high tensile steel wire that diameter is 3.5-4.5mm At fenestral fabric so that mesh sheet 2 have sufficiently high intensity and anti-shearing force.
The mesh of mesh sheet 2 is rectangular opening, and the width of rectangular opening in the horizontal direction is 10-15mm and preferably 12.7mm, edge The height of vertical direction is 75-80mm and preferably 76.2mm.Lesser width makes the finger of people that can not be inserted into net at all In hole, sufficiently small width and height make the anti-impact force with super strength of mesh sheet 2, and mesh height is intensive, have extremely strong anti- Climbing and shearing resistance cutting capacity, and also can see all in lattice column net with good sight.
When specifically used, the fixing end of overhanging piece 5 is located above the utility model, free end is located below, and 6, nut In 5 lower end of overhanging piece, accordingly, places window 7 and be located at interspersed 8 top of window.When installation, by the outside at the edge of mesh sheet 2 and column 1 Fitting, nut 6 is passed through to place window 7 and is moved at interspersed window 8, then by bolt 4 pass through after inserting hole 10 and interspersed window 8 with Nut 6 is threadedly coupled, and the vertical pole at positive stop strip 9 and 2 edge of mesh sheet is clamped, and is overcome conventionally employed self-tapping screw and is not easy to pacify The problem of filling, easily corrode and falling off, substantially increases installation effectiveness and installation quality.
